Call for CVs: Language Instructors - All Languages
ANNOUNCEMENT TYPE: Call for CVs
LEVEL : Entry-level to Subject Matter Expert
LOCATION : Various - primarily remote
TYPE : Consultant/Contract, Part Time, and Full Time Regular Employment options anticipated
McColm & Company is a mission-driven consulting firm that equips change makers with the knowledge, skills, and insights they need to succeed in an increasingly complex world. McColm specializes in supporting U.S. federal customers with foreign affairs and national security portfolios by designing and managing bespoke professional training programs, delivering effective capacity building solutions, and by providing highly specialized technical assistance and analysis expertise to decision makers.
McColm is expanding its bench of language instructors across all languages for current contract requirements, and future opportunities contingent upon contract awards, supporting U.S. Government customers.
We are seeking instructors who can deliver high-impact, proficiency-oriented instruction grounded in best practices for adult language learning , with strong familiarity and experience using the Interagency Language Roundtable (ILR) scale for instructional design and assessment.
Position Responsibilities
- Design and deliver language instruction that develops functional proficiency from foundational communication through advanced performance (e.g., professional/technical topics as required).
- Plan instruction using measurable proficiency objectives mapped to ILR levels (e.g., tasks, functions, accuracy, and discourse control expected at target levels).
- Create learning experiences that prioritize real-world communication : speaking and listening (and reading/writing when required) with meaningful tasks and performance outcomes.
- Use best-practice methodology such as:
- communicative/task-based instruction,
- high-frequency, feedback-rich speaking practice,
- strategic grammar and vocabulary instruction in support of communication,
- differentiation and scaffolding for mixed proficiency needs,
- learner autonomy techniques (goal-setting, practice planning, reflection).
- Build psychologically safe learning environments that motivate adult professionals and maintain high expectations.
- Develop lesson plans, syllabi, and learning materials aligned to program goals and learner proficiency.
- Adapt authentic materials (news, professional documents, audio/video) appropriately for level and instructional purpose.
- Integrate technology effectively for virtual learning (platform tools, shared docs, digital resources).
- Demonstrate working knowledge of the ILR scale , including what performance “looks like” across levels.
- Support placement, progress checks, and readiness activities using ILR-aligned performance tasks (e.g., role plays, presentations, interviews, summaries, professional scenarios).
- Provide clear, actionable learner feedback tied to proficiency indicators (strengths, gaps, next-step targets).
- Maintain reliable scheduling and timely communication with program staff.
- Complete required documentation (e.g., session notes, learner progress inputs) as specified by the contract/program.
- Uphold confidentiality and professional conduct in U.S. Government training environments.
Requirements
Requirements are determined by each specific opportunity, however the following requirements are generally desired.
- Demonstrated experience teaching or coaching languages to adult learners (in-person and/or virtual).
- Native or near-native proficiency in the target language(s) and strong instructional command of English (as applicable to the role).
- Demonstrated ability to design instruction around proficiency outcomes (ILR/ACTFL-informed approaches welcomed).
- Experience delivering structured instruction in a virtual environment (Zoom or comparable platforms).
- Strong interpersonal skills, reliability, and learner-centered professionalism.
- Direct experience using the ILR scale for curriculum alignment, learner goal setting, and performance-based feedback.
- Experience preparing learners for ILR-style speaking/listening performance expectations (e.g., guided interview practice).
- Government, military, foreign affairs, or professional language program experience.
- Training/certifications in language pedagogy, instructional design, or assessment.
